Doris Kusumoto

Aileen and I go back to kindergarten at Freedom School, but it wasn’t until 5th grade we became friends. She was a lot of fun, always game to try new things. In high school we rode the bus in together, so we talked a lot. Once she mentioned about a kind thing Joe Richards had done and she was so taken. (As everyone has expressed, that was the effect Joe had.) Aileen and I carpooled all through Cabrillo. When Ronnie Huber was killed in that accident it hit us hard, just as Jan Proctor and Pat Gaither had reacted. After Cabrillo, Aileen went to Sacramento State and was always active in various causes. We kept in touch through college and a short time thereafter, but soon we lost touch. It was through my brother, who knows her cousin, I learned she had passed away after a lengthy illness. It saddened me I had lost contact and had not even known she had been ill.
